| Other Cancers: Leukemia and Childhood Cancers |

| A study in the British Journal of Cancer found that children whose fathers smoked a |
| pack a day or more had a 30% higher risk for developing cancer than did other |
| children. "Damaged sperm is the likeliest culprit," said one of the study doctors, from |
| the University of Birmingham, England. |
| Reuters, November 18, 1997 |

| In a study from Shanghai, China, "paternal smoking prior to conception may be |
| associated with an increased risk for all childhood cancers combined and particularly |
| for childhood acute lymphoblastic leukemia, lymphoma, and brain tumors. The |
| elevated cancer risk was confined to children under age 5 years at diagnosis and |
| associated with paternal smoking starting prior to conception, suggesting the |
| possibility of prezygotic genetic damage." Children whose fathers smoked more than |
| five pack-years prior to their conception had adjusted odds ratios of 3.8 for acute |
| lymphoblastic leukemia, 4.5 for lymphoma, 2.7 for brain tumors, and 1.7 for all cancers |
| combined. Other studies have found an increase in neuroblastoma and |
| rhabdomyosarcoma in children whose fathers smoke. Cigarette smoking increases |
| oxidative DNA damage in human sperm cells, and causes mutations in germ cells. |
| Journal of the National Cancer Institute, February 5, 1997, pp. 238-244 |
